The Design And Implement Of Nonlinear Excitation Controller

This paper works on power systems nonlinear excitation controller, the nonlinear excitation arithmetic based on differential geometry is studied theoretically, and analyze the influence of this kinds of controller to the power system, and talk about how to implement such a controller.In the analysis of nonlinear excitation exact arithmetic linearigation theory, talk about some basic formula and theory of nonlinear math, analyze the theory and practical arithmetic of the nonlinear system. This arithmetic could been used in a lot of areas.The math analysis of synchronous generator is given, this analysis is based on Park transform, and give out the state equation of a single generator infinite net system. By exact linearization arithmetic, the practical controller rule was given out. Then the paper analyzes the influence to the power net of nonlinear excitation controller.The paper gives out the pivotal technique to implement this system, include AC sampling technique, implement of control arithmetic and the implement of pulse, Fourier transform was used to implement the AC sampling, the paper introduces the implement of control arithmetic and pulse, the system realizes the relevant function.
